Partnering with law enforcement

Organizers are coordinating with police, securing venues, and setting clear bag policies. Those partnerships allow events to proceed peacefully while deterring troublemakers.

Providing volunteer greeters and medical teams also ensures that families feel safe without the atmosphere turning cold or impersonal.

Security directors are developing after-action reports that can be shared with churches and civic groups nationwide so best practices spread quickly.
